Our approach

The University of the Highlands and Islands (UHI) is a diverse and flexible tertiary partnership serving our communities and connected to their needs.

We are a regionally focused partnership of independent colleges and research institutions covering the largest geographical area of any campus-based university or college in the UK. We have one of the largest student bodies in Scotland, with nearly 31,000 students studying with us each year, and we contribute £560 million annually to the region, indirectly supporting 6,200 jobs. As a multiplier effect, UHI puts back £4 for every £1 spent into the economies of the Highlands and Islands, Moray and Perthshire.
